Commuting to Sebenza is straightforward by taxi. The main hub is the Sebenza Taxi Stop at Buwbes Road & Terrace Road. From Tembisa, expect R25–R30 and 35–45 minutes. From Alexandra or Germiston, it's R20–R25 and 30–40 minutes. Plan your journey to arrive early for morning shifts, as traffic can build up. There are no direct train or bus routes, so taxis are your primary option.
From the Sebenza Taxi Stop (Buwbes Road & Terrace Road), most employment nodes are within walking distance. Mpact Plastics / Corrugated's main gate is a short walk down Mopedi Road. Berry Astrapak's security office is also close by on Buwbes Road. Various light engineering firms are scattered throughout the inner grid of Sebenza, easily accessible from the main roads.
About This Role: Call Centre Trainer / Learning & Development Facilitator
Design and deliver training programmes that upskill call centre agents in product knowledge, systems, compliance, and soft skills. Trainers are the engine of quality in high-volume contact centres across South Africa.
Key Duties & Responsibilities
- Train new call centre agents on product knowledge for industrial packaging and engineering solutions.
- Monitor live calls and provide constructive feedback on agent performance and customer interaction.
- Develop and update training materials specific to new products or service changes in manufacturing.
- Coach agents on handling complex customer complaints and technical queries efficiently.
- Conduct refresher training sessions to improve communication skills and sales support techniques.
- Assist with onboarding new staff, ensuring they master call centre software and systems.
- Prepare daily and weekly performance reports for call centre management in Sebenza.
- Ensure all agents understand and adhere to company policies and industry regulations.
Requirements
- Matric (Grade 12)
- Minimum 2–3 years call centre agent experience
- Facilitation or Training qualification (ODETDP / ETD NQF Level 5 advantageous)
- Excellent communication and presentation skills
- Proficiency in MS Office (PowerPoint, Excel, Word)

Salary Range
R14,000 – R24,000 per month
The salary for a Call Centre Trainer in Sebenza ranges from R14,000 to R24,000 per month, based on ShiftMate placement data. This range depends heavily on your experience, the size of the employer (e.g., a large plant like Mpact Plastics versus a smaller engineering firm), and the complexity of the products you're training on. More specialized industrial knowledge can push you towards the higher end. Remember, the national minimum wage is R28.79 per hour in 2026, setting a solid floor for all earnings.
In Sebenza, Call Centre Trainers typically earn R14,000–R24,000. This is competitive, often aligning closely with similar roles in central Ekurhuleni like Kempton Park, though potentially slightly lower than national averages for corporate call centres in major CBDs.
Pay Scale — Call Centre Trainer / Learning & Development Facilitator
| Level | Pay Rate |
|---|---|
| Junior Trainer / Facilitator | R14,000 – R18,000 / month |
| Senior Trainer | R18,000 – R24,000 / month |
| L&D Manager / Training Manager | R28,000 – R45,000+ / month |
Pay rates are estimates based on South African sectoral determinations and market data for the Ekurhuleni area. Actual pay may vary by employer.
Safety Tips for Sebenza
Sebenza is generally safe during working hours. Terrace Road remains relatively busy, but the inner industrial grid gets very quiet and dark after 5 PM. It's always wise to walk in groups to the main taxi stops on Buwbes Road during early morning or late evening commutes. Avoid carrying visible valuables to minimize risk.
